In Elijah’s Israel of 900 BC, truth was often compromised as the people steadily departed from the worship of the one true God. It was a multifaith society where immorality reached the highest level. Tolerance trumped truth, much like Western society today. What are Christians to do in such a spiritual and moral climate? Elijah is our great example and inspiration as we dare to contend for the truth, even challenging the religious establishment if necessary. What could be more relevant for the Christian church at the present time?

John Cheeseman went to school at Epsom College in Surrey and was converted to Christianity at the age of 17. He studied classics at Oxford University, before training for pastoral ministry at Trinity College, Bristol. He has served in churches all over the southeast of England, most recently at Holy Trinity, Eastbourne, where he was the Vicar of a large town center church.
